I am a PhD student in the Computer Vision Group at the University of Bonn, supervised by Prof. Jürgen Gall. My research focuses on multimodal learning, foundation models, and representation learning. I am also involved in PhenoRob and AgriScienceFM. Previously, I received my MSc in Artificial Intelligence from the University of Bologna and worked as an R&D intern at Datalogic in the US.
